keil 32 hello world
时间: 2023-10-21 19:05:00 浏览: 156
在 Keil uVision 中,可以使用以下代码进行 "Hello World" 的输出:
```c
#include <stdio.h>
int main() {
printf("Hello World!\n");
return 0;
}
```
步骤如下:
1. 在 Keil uVision 中创建一个新项目,并添加一个 C 文件。
2. 将上述代码复制到 C 文件中。
3. 在菜单栏中选择 "Project" -> "Build Target",或使用快捷键 "F7" 进行编译。
4. 在菜单栏中选择 "Debug" -> "Start/Stop Debug Session",或使用快捷键 "Ctrl + F5" 运行程序。
相关问题
keil5打印hello world
要在Keil5中打印"Hello world",可以按照以下步骤操作:
1. 打开Keil5软件,并创建一个新的工程。
2. 在工程中创建一个新的源文件,命名为"main.c"或其他你喜欢的名称。
3. 在"main.c"文件中编写以下代码:
```
#include <stdio.h>
int main() {
printf("Hello world\n");
return 0;
}
```
4. 保存并编译工程,确保没有错误。
5. 连接你的单片机,选择正确的目标设备并下载程序。
6. 运行程序,在Keil5的UART #1串口窗口中,你将会看到"Hello world"的输出。
请注意,你可能需要手动打开Keil软件中的UART #1串口窗口以查看程序的输出。
stm32的hello world怎么实现
在STM32中实现Hello World可以通过串口通信来实现。具体步骤如下:
1. 首先需要在STM32上配置串口通信,可以使用USART模块来实现。USART是通用同步异步收发器,可以实现全双工数据交换。
2. 在主程序中添加代码,使用HAL库来实现串口通信。可以使用HAL_UART_Transmit函数来发送数据,使用HAL_UART_Receive函数来接收数据。
3. 进行软件仿真,可以使用Keil等软件进行仿真测试。
4. 将程序烧录到单片机中,连接电脑并使用串口调试助手等工具来观察结果,如果串口输出正常,则Hello World实现成功。